Model Configuration and Data Manager

Key Role:

Creates processes, integrates, and applies interdisciplinary digital model configuration of products from concept throughout the product lifecycle. Applies advanced consulting skills, extensive technical expertise, and full industry knowledge. Develops innovative solutions to complex problems. Works without considerable direction. Mentors and may supervise team members. Engineer model-based systems configuration and data management to support our client's Digital Engineering mission. Advise with the government on the weapons ecosystem and Open System Architecture design approaches for new weapon concepts. Provide configuration processes and procedures for the oversight of development of digital models, engineering plans, and reports as needed to support this development.

Basic Qualifications:

  • 5+ years of experience with Digital Engineering and MBSE for DoD weapon systems

  • Experience with MBSE tools such as Magic Draw or Cameo, Sparx Enterprise Architect, IBM Rhapsody, Teamcenter, MATLAB, and Simulink, and processes to create and manage tailored MBSE artifacts that capture analysis and the resulting engineering decisions and trades made during acquisition and development

  • Experience with system engineering life cycle, including requirements, design, development, integration, testing, and deployment for major DoD weapon systems

  • Experience with conducting model-based performance simulations to determine the impact of requirements changes on system performance and behaviors

  • Knowledge of WOSA design principles and technologies, DoD architecture standards and framework, and Agile systems engineering methods and tools

  • Ability to work effectively in a multi-disciplinary, dynamic team environment, including internal staff, external contractors, and government clients, to increase the use of MBSE for client acquisition programs

  • Secret clearance

  • Bachelor's degree in Engineering, Science, or Mathematics

Additional Qualifications:

  • Knowledge of using system models during government engineering reviews

  • Knowledge of other system engineering disciplines, including configuration management and risk management

  • Knowledge of Agile Project Management

  • Master's degree in Engineering, Science, or Mathematics

  • OCSMP Fundamental Certication

  • INCOSE Certified Systems Engineering Professional (CSEP) Certification
